How 2025 tariff measures reshaped sourcing strategies, procurement behavior, and supply resiliency decisions across the fire stopping materials value chain

The cumulative effects of tariff actions implemented in the United States during 2025 introduced new cost and sourcing pressures that reverberate across the fire stopping materials ecosystem. Input materials such as specialty silicones, fillers, and treated board substrates experienced altered landed cost dynamics, prompting procurement teams to reassess supplier footprints and to pursue alternative sourcing strategies that reduce exposure to trade volatility. In response, some manufacturers accelerated nearshoring and developed dual-sourcing plans to mitigate single-origin risk while preserving lead time reliability for critical projects.

Procurement behavior adjusted to incorporate total-cost considerations, including freight variability and customs handling, leading to longer-term contractual relationships with local converters and distributors that could offer inventory buffers and value-added services. At the same time, price sensitivity among certain segments of the buyer community encouraged product reformulation toward material mixes that deliver acceptable performance at lower cost. For installers and contractors, the tariffs amplified the incentive to adopt fit-for-purpose alternatives where allowed by code and testing, which intensified competition between legacy formulations and newer cost-effective variants.

Regulatory stakeholders and owners became more attentive to the resilience of supply for safety-critical materials, increasing scrutiny of continuity-of-supply plans during procurement evaluation. As a result, manufacturers that communicated transparent sourcing strategies, demonstrated capacity flexibility, and provided robust technical support gained a comparative advantage in tender processes. The combined response to tariff-driven disruption reinforced the strategic importance of diversified sourcing, close collaboration with specifiers, and investment in manufacturing agility to sustain market access and project throughput.

A nuanced segmentation perspective revealing how product categories, application environments, and new construction versus retrofit contexts determine selection criteria and supplier strategies

A focused segmentation lens clarifies how product types and application contexts intersect with end-use priorities, shaping specification and purchasing behavior. Based on Product Type, the market is studied across Acrylic Sealants, Board Products, Intumescent Sealants, Mortars And Cements, and Silicone Sealants, and each category serves distinct performance and installation use cases: acrylics offer ease of use for non-critical joints, boards provide passive barrier assemblies for compartmentation, intumescent sealants deliver expansion properties around combustibles, mortars and cements address block and service penetrations with robust structural fill, and silicone sealants provide durable, flexible seals for service continuity under movement.

Based on Market Landscape, market is studied across Application and End Use. The Application is further studied across Ductwork, Fire Doors, and Wall Penetrations. The End Use is further studied across New Construction and Retrofit. These lenses reveal meaningful patterns: ductwork applications prioritize materials that maintain fire and smoke integrity while accommodating vibration and thermal cycling; fire door interfaces require solutions that preserve rated assemblies without impairing operation; and wall penetrations demand materials that reconcile variable substrate conditions and installer trade sequencing. New construction projects typically allow for integrated design coordination and specification-driven procurement, while retrofit contexts emphasize fast-setting materials, on-site tolerances, and minimal disruption to occupied spaces. Understanding the interplay among product types, application demands, and end-use conditions is essential for manufacturers when positioning product portfolios, for distributors when structuring inventory assortments, and for specifiers when writing resilient, test-backed system specifications.

Regional market dynamics and regulatory nuances that drive distinct demand patterns, specification behavior, and supply chain strategies across global construction markets

Regional dynamics underscore different drivers for adoption, procurement, and innovation across major geographies, each shaped by regulatory regimes, construction cycles, and supply chain architectures. The Americas exhibit concentrated demand in both urban megaprojects and retrofit programs driven by stringent fire code enforcement and insurance-driven risk management practices, with a focus on installer training and documented system compliance. Europe, Middle East & Africa reflects a complex mosaic where harmonized standards and localized certification pathways coexist, encouraging manufacturers to pursue regional testing strategies and to collaborate with local distributors to navigate diverse regulatory environments.

Asia-Pacific is characterized by rapid urbanization, large-scale infrastructure investment, and an accelerating move toward performance-based codes in many jurisdictions, leading to heightened demand for tested systems and scalable production. Across these geographies, the relative balance between new construction and retrofit activity influences product mix preferences, with boards and mortars commonly specified in large-scale compartmentation programs and intumescent and silicone solutions favored where movement accommodation and aesthetic continuity are priorities. Additionally, logistics and tariff considerations impact inventory strategies differently by region, prompting multinational suppliers to tailor supply chain footprints and regional service capabilities to meet local expectations for lead time consistency and technical support.
